Studio Coordinator (Part-Time)

Marek Wojciechowski Architects is seeking an enthusiastic and organised Studio Coordinator to support our busy west end office on a part-time basis. We welcome applicants who are looking to work between the hours of 9am-3pm daily .

Responsibilities:

  • Ensure the practice adheres to ISO 9001 procedures and manage the annual audit.
  • Assist with diary management for the studio and directors, as well as other administrative tasks as required.
  • Oversee studio operations, serving as the first point of contact for incoming enquiries.
  • Keep the studio presentable and organised.
  • Prepare meeting rooms ahead of client meetings and arrange refreshments for their arrival.
  • Provide support to the team to ensure the smooth running of the office, including processing orders and supplies.
  • Contribute to the development of practice policies and the archiving system.
  • Monitor the info inbox to ensure all enquiries are addressed promptly.
  • Manage office supplies, including ordering the weekly grocery shop and restocking stationary as needed.
